Bonjour à tous,
J'ai un fichier excel contenant 10 onglets et je voudrais générer un PDF unique avec les 10 onglets (ou feuilles), donc un PDF de 10 feuilles.
J'ai la macro suivante qui fonctionne mais uniquement pour la feuille active :
Sub PDF_SAVE()
Dim LHeure As String, LaDate As String
LHeure = Format(Time, "HMS")
LaDate = Format(Date, "dd" & "." & "mm" & "." & "yyyy")
' Création fichier PDF
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, Filename:= _
"P:\11-MAIRIES\MAPC-CDE\Commun\Pôle achat marché\MARCHES\23M02 - Lessiviel - Entretien - Hygiène - EPI\BDC\Bon de commande MR NET du " & LaDate & " " & LHeure & ".pdf", Quality:= _
xlQualityStandard, IncludeDocProperties:=True, IgnorePrintAreas:=False, _
From:=1, To:=1, OpenAfterPublish:=True
' Message de confirmation
MsgBox ("Bon de commande MR NET créé" & vbCrLf & vbCrLf & "Merci ")
End Sub
Edit modo : code à mettre entre balises avec le bouton </> merci d'y faire attention la prochaine fois
Avez-vous une idée ?
Merci d'avance.